any dell 991 19" monitor owners here?
I just picked up this monitor last week and so far am really disappointed. Not sure if its really as bad as I think or if its just that my 19" LCD samsung has spoiled me forever with CRT monitors.... Anyhow, does anyone here have this monitor? if so, I'd really, really like to have your opinion of it. And as what color scheme you use (if any)? and ask what your brightness and contrast are set to? and if you have to change all settings once you go into a game as it goes waaaay dark?? I have to lighten it way up in game then when I come back out to desktop its way bright and washed out and have to adjust back down again. Is that normal for this monitor? Help?!?!

Yessuh, proud owner of one right here  Color scheme? Um... I just use the 9300K setting. For games, yes, it does get suprisingly dark, so for games I have contrast at 100 and brightness anywhere from 30 to 50, for normal desktop, brightness is ideally at 15 or so. It's a damn good monitor compared to other CRTs, so I guess you just got too used to an LCD

This whole entire thread is EXACTLY why I am going to miss my gf4ti4200-- Digital Vibrance is the most under appreciated feature of Nvidia drivers. Without it my games and desktop just don't "pop" off the screen like they do when its on. I'm gonna love the speed of my new ATI, but I am not going to like the absence of DV or something simular.
I have a Flat 17'' CRT with a built in anti-reflective and anti-glare screen. You should at least try these color settings, I noticed it helped one day when I spent hours trying to get it just right.
---Shuki--
It sounds crazy, but try this:
*user level color control and set them all (R,G,B) to 85% or higher- try 100% and see what it looks like.
*contrast 100%
*brightness 10% to 25% set afteryou adjust color to highest setings that still look right.
---worked for me before I had mt gf4 w/ Digital Vibrance.
*and if there is a video level adjustment make sure it is on .7v and not 1.0v-- that makes my screen dark when set wrong.
